Preview
Mali and Mozambique meet at Stade 26 Mars, in a match for this stage of the Africa Cup of Nations Qualification (Group Stage). There is no recent record of official head‑to‑heads between these two teams. The last head‑to‑head was played on 19‑01‑2014 and ended with the final score: Mozambique (1‑2) Mali. The home advantage may play an important role in this match , since Mali presents significant differences between home and away results.

Analysis Mali

The home team makes its debut in this edition of the Africa Cup of Nations Qualification with the intention of getting a positive result, using the home advantage in their favour. This is a team that is often stronger at home, with the help of its supporters, so they usually make good use of the home advantage, since in the last 30 matches they register 5 wins, 7 draws and 3 losses in away matches; against 10 wins, 4 draws and 1 loss at their stadium. They come to this match after a away draw against Madagascar by (0‑0). Mali has won 6, tied 1 and lost 3 of the last 10 home matches. Their offense has scored consistently, as they have scored goals in 8 of the last 10 matches. In their home matches there is a tendency for goals, since 12 of the last 14 matches have ended with Over 1,5 goals. This is a team that likes to score first. They have opened up the score in 13 of the last 15 matches, they have reached half‑time in front in 7 of those 13 matches and have held on to the lead until the end of the 90' in 9 of them.

Mali come for this game after a goalless draw away to Madagascar. Coach Tom Saintfiet is expected to return to a 4-4-2,  with the aim of taking advantage of counterattacks. In this tactical formation, the two players responsible for keeping the opposing defense in check should be El Bilal Touré and Dorgeles Nene. It is worth noting that the man responsible for directing his country’s attacks in the best possible way is midfielder Amadou Haidara. All players are available for this game.

Analysis Mozambique

The team plays its first match in this edition of the Africa Cup of Nations Qualification with the intention of getting a positive away result. This is a team that usually maintains its competitive level in home and away matches, since in the last 30 matches they register 4 wins, 4 draws and 7 losses in away matches, with 16 goals scored and 27 conceded; against 5 wins, 4 draws and 6 losses at their stadium, with 18 goals scored and 19 conceded. In their last match, for the WC Qualification Africa, they got an away win against Guinea by (0‑1). In the last 10 away matches Mozambique has won 3, tied 4 and lost 3. Defensive consistency hasn’t been their best feature, as they have conceded goals in 8 of the last 10 matches, but their offense has scored consistently, as they have scored goals in 8 of the last 10 matches. In 15 matches, they have conceded the first goal 7 times and have only turned the score around in 1.

Mozambique come for this match after a 0-1 victory at the Guinea stadium: the only goal of the match was scored by Geny Catamo. The Mozambican team usually play in a traditional 4-3-3, with the three forwards being Witi, Geny Catamo and Clésio Baúque. Midfielder Guima is the player responsible for implementing his vision of the game and providing the best possible service to his forwards. All players are available for this match.
